Taunt Turns a Town Into Spin City
Date: 16 April 2000
By Robert Worth
Robert Worth
Recent suspension of 11-year-old Nicholas Aldini from his school in Larchmont, New York, becomes example of how parent can use media to distort decision by school that is constrained by law from responding; Amy Aldini immediately called news media when sixth grader was suspended for 'sexually harrassing' girls with silly poem, but other parents say incident was only culmination of many disciplinary problems that boy's parents refused to address in cooperative way; mother did get school to lift suspension two days early; photo (M)

C.I.A. Tried, With Little Success, to Use U.S. Press in Coup
Date: 16 April 2000
By James Risen
James Risen
Internal Central Intelligence Agency report shows CIA officials planning 1953 coup in Iran tried, with little success, to plant articles in American newspapers saying Shah Mohammed Reza Pahlevi's return resulted from homegrown revolt against Communist-leaning government; says none of Americans covering coup worked for CIA; analysis of press coverage shows American journalists filed straight-forward factual dispatches, but did not mention that some of street violence was stage-managed by CIA agents posing as Communists and gave little stress to accurate reports in Iranian newspapers that Western powers were secretly arranging shah's return to power (M)
